London Blackfriars prides itself on being a modern, well-equipped station with amenities designed to make your journey seamless. The station is equipped with a ticket office open throughout the week and multiple ticket machines for easy purchases, all of which are designed to be accessible. Offering step-free access throughout, it is classified as a Category A station, ensuring unimpeded access to all platforms. For tech-savvy travelers, smartcards are available, complete with validators for quick access.
Customer service is at the forefront at London Blackfriars. If you ever need assistance, help points are stationed at key areas. Although there's no dedicated waiting room, there are ample seating areas fully covered on all platforms, allowing for a comfortable wait. CCTV operations are in place to ensure passenger safety, and toilets, including accessible options, are located conveniently in the booking hall on the Northbank side.

Getting your tickets at Stoke-on-Trent station is a breeze. With a ticket office open on weekdays from 05:55 to 20:00 and a host of ticket machines available on-site, upgrading your travel plans at the last minute is never an issue. If you've purchased tickets online, collection is also straightforward via a convenient ticket machine, though it's worth noting that the ticket machines are presently not accessible for those with mobility impairments.
To ensure a comfortable journey for all passengers, the station features step-free access throughout. While there are no accessible taxis directly at the station, there is a set-down and pick-up point for impaired mobility passengers. A variety of staff-led support services are available from 05:30 to midnight on weekdays, ready to assist with any inquiries. Whether it's directions, train times or a bit of assistance with luggage, help is always at hand.
Transport connections are robust, offering multiple ways to continue your journey once you've stepped off the train at Stoke-on-Trent. If you're catching a ride by bike, you can make use of the Brompton Bike Hire located at the station. For bus connections, Stoke-on-Trent station provides direct access to rail replacement services right at its doorstep. A landscaped bus interchange is also available, providing printable information to plan your onward journey for ultimate convenience.
